熟悉W3C规范,能熟练编写具有良好风格规范的HTML+CSS代码,熟练掌握jQuery,熟悉JavaScript语言的各特性,有JS性能优化的实践经验,熟悉ES5/ES6语法。
熟练掌握Ajax,能与后端很好的合作,完成前后端分离架构的研发工作,能够解决跨域请求访问问题;
熟悉Nodejs,npm工具,以及常用的框架express;
有很好的Vue、React 开发经验。
一、资源分享平台
项目技术:Bootstrap、TypeScript、Angular、node.js、mysql
项目描述:以angualr为前端框架,node.js为后端服务器实现的资源分享网站。实现了注册、登陆,在线编辑头像,上 传、下载资源,积分商店,关注用户,排行榜等功能。
项目职责:页面设计、页面实现、API设计、后端实现、数据库设计。
二、Electron桌面应用-区块链钱包
项目技术:electron、node.js、express、nedb、vue、vuex
项目描述:为应用区块链节点提供图形化操作界面。
项目职责:express服务器接口实现及相关数据库操作、应用主进程管理、部分渲染进程页面、让程序兼容Windows Linux MacOS操作系统。